Thanks James, I'm using the TnT POS Tagger, and I treat it as a black box, otherwise I have to write my own, which is a huge task. The Segmenter I use is home-grown, and it is supposedly the best available. I used to evaluate on whole words, and this was easy. After the segmentation and tagging, I combined the various segments of each word, and this elimintaed the discrepancy in alignment. For example, I would have an output like this: the+man Det+Noun the+man Det+Noun who+came+to+us <tag> whocame+to+us <wrongTag> It is easy to do it this way if you use a WORD_END_DELIMITER, but this is very tedious, and you have to recalculate the segment accuracy.
